The Harman Kardon BDS 570 is a 5.1-channel Blu-ray home theater system released in the early 2010s. Firmware updates for this device are critical for maintaining Blu-ray disc playback compatibility, improving system stability, and resolving HDMI handshake issues. You need a standard USB drive formatted to the FAT32 file system. Ensure the drive has at least 500 MB of free space.
After any update, it is critical to restore the unit to factory defaults to ensure stability: Go to > System > Restore Defaults and confirm.
